Transaction 34fb23fbf636a54b622ced177a78249bc1134d24023453a12253039bbd339f23

1 Input
2 Outputs
  • 34fb23fbf636a54b622ced177a78249bc1134d24023453a12253039bbd339f23:0
  • value  205621889
    address  1B8VC5QbjDPixAFicCyf4AYwc9yThT6s7p
  • 34fb23fbf636a54b622ced177a78249bc1134d24023453a12253039bbd339f23:1
  • value  18623949267
    address  14fpRFEuDtPaiEdH7qHN2dLbqyJCAtr6Uz